Men’s Soccer Battles to Draw at #5 Oklahoma Wesleyan

BARTLESVILLE, Okla. -- In what has become a nearly annual rivalry, the John Brown University men's soccer squad earned a 3-3 draw at No. 5 Oklahoma Wesleyan on Monday (Aug. 25) evening at the OKWU Soccer Complex.

Sophomore Alejandro Gallardo and freshman Constantin Bauer each recorded a goal and an assists (3 points), helping the Golden Eagles (0-1-1) to two second-half goals to pull out the draw against a second-consecutive NAIA top-10 ranked side.

After OKWU struck first early with a goal in the fourth minute of play, John Brown settled down and took advantage of an individual effort from Gallardo, the reigning SAC Freshman of the Year, who leveled the match at one in the 20th minute.

While the host Eagles (0-0-1) took a 2-1 lead into halftime, the Blue and Gold responded with a pair of goals over a 10-minute span to take a 3-2 lead.

In the 58th minute, junior Atim Roper redirected a Bauer corner kick to shock the home supporters and tie the match again at two apiece.

Less than 10 minutes later, on a brilliant counter-attack, Gallardo played the ball up to sophomore Marcos Miranda up the left flank before Miranda sent a perfect pass into the box, finished by Bauer for his first collegiate goal and a 3-2 advantage for the visitors.

Oklahoma Wesleyan would eventually go on to level the match again in the 78th minute, but neither side was able to find the game-winner as the Golden Eagles move to 2-1-2 in its last five matchups in Bartlesville.

Senior Adam Tebbs made a pair of saves to move to 0-1-1 on the season. OKWU keeper Marko Rodic made one save while allowing three in the Wesleyan season debut.

The Blue and Gold will now take a break from top-10 action when the Golden Eagles welcome Hesston (Kan.) to Alumni Field for First Friday Futbol action, slated for a 7:30 p.m. kickoff on Aug. 29. It will be the first matchup of the sides in program history as the visiting Larks recently transitioned into a four-year NAIA program.
